What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Internship Seismic Data Processing Geophysicist,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Internship Seismic Data Processing Geophysicist, you need a solid background in geophysics or a related field, strong analytical abilities, and foundational knowledge of seismic data principles. Familiarity with industry-standard seismic processing software (such as ProMAX, Petrel, or SeisSpace) and basic programming skills in languages like Python or MATLAB are highly beneficial. Attention to detail, problem-solving aptitude, and effective communication are essential soft skills for interpreting complex data and collaborating with multidisciplinary teams. These skills ensure accurate seismic analysis and contribute to successful exploration and development projects within the geoscience industry.

What types of projects and responsibilities can I expect as an Internship Seismic Data Processing Geophysicist?

As an Internship Seismic Data Processing Geophysicist, you will typically work alongside experienced geophysicists to process and analyze seismic data collected from field surveys. Your responsibilities may include using specialized software to clean, filter, and interpret raw seismic signals, assisting with quality control, and generating preliminary subsurface images. You’ll often participate in team meetings to discuss project progress and may be asked to present your findings. This role offers valuable hands-on experience in seismic workflows and provides opportunities to learn about current industry technologies and practices.

What does an Internship Seismic Data Processing Geophysicist do?

An Internship Seismic Data Processing Geophysicist assists in analyzing and interpreting seismic data collected from geophysical surveys, primarily for oil, gas, and mineral exploration. Interns learn to use specialized software to process raw seismic signals and help convert them into subsurface images that geoscientists use to identify rock layers and potential resource locations. They often work as part of a team, supporting senior geophysicists by preparing data, generating reports, and troubleshooting data quality issues while gaining practical experience in geophysical methods and data analysis.

What is the difference between Internship Seismic Data Processing Geophysicist vs Seismic Data Processing Geophysicist?

AspectInternship Seismic Data Processing GeophysicistSeismic Data Processing Geophysicist
CredentialsTypically pursuing or recent graduate in geophysics or related fieldBachelor's or master's degree in geophysics or geology, with relevant certifications
Work EnvironmentInternship setting, supervised, entry-level tasksFull-time professional role, independent project work
Employer & IndustryOil & gas companies, geophysical service firms, research institutionsOil & gas companies, seismic service providers, consulting firms

The main difference between an Internship Seismic Data Processing Geophysicist and a Seismic Data Processing Geophysicist lies in experience level and responsibilities. Interns are in training, gaining foundational skills, while full professionals handle complex data processing tasks independently. Both roles are essential in the industry, with internships serving as stepping stones to full employment.
